How to submit an application for layout design of integrated circuits?

The exclusive right of integrated circuit layout design is registered in China National Intellectual Property Administration. To obtain the exclusive right of layout-design, it is necessary to apply to China National Intellectual Property Administration for registration and go through relevant formalities.

What documents should the applicant submit when registering the layout design of integrated circuits?

(1) Documents that must be submitted:

(1) An application form for registration of the exclusive right of layout-design of integrated circuits (relevant forms can be downloaded from the website of www.cnipa.gov.cn, China National Intellectual Property Administration).

(2) a model.

③ Drawing catalogue.

(2) Documents that may need to be submitted:

(1) the layout-design that has been put into commercial use before the application date shall submit four samples when applying for registration.

(2) If the applicant entrusts an agency, it shall also submit a power of attorney for the exclusive right to register the layout-design of integrated circuits.

(3) In addition, the applicant may also submit:

(1) CD containing layout-designed electronic components.

② Brief introduction of layout design.

Format requirements of application documents

(1) pattern: it includes the general layout and layered layout, and is printed on A4 paper in a size suitable for A4 paper; Print a picture on each page; When there are multiple drawings, they should be numbered in sequence.

(2) Drawing Catalogue: The name of the layer of each drawing shall be indicated.

(3) Samples: The four submitted samples of integrated circuits shall be placed in special instruments, and the name of the applicant and the name of the integrated circuit layout design shall be marked on the surface of the instruments.

(4) Brief description: Explain the structure, process, function and other matters that need to be explained in the layout design of integrated circuits.

(5) CD-ROM: Electronic files with layout design patterns are stored in CD-ROM. The name of the applicant and the name of the integrated circuit shall be written on the surface of the CD.

Integrated circuit layout design registration process

Application-review-acceptance notice and payment notice-registration announcement-registration certificate

Common reasons for inadmissibility

(1) Failing to submit an application for layout design registration or a copy or pattern of layout design, failing to submit an integrated circuit sample that has been put into commercial use, or failing to submit the above items;

(2) The layout-design expires 15 years from the date of creation;

(3) The layout-design has been used for two years since its first commercial use;

(4) the application category is unclear or it is difficult to determine whether it belongs to layout design, such as circuit board design;

(5) Failing to entrust an agency as required.
